Kindle Paperwhite (5th gen): 6.9 in (175 mm) H 4.9 in (124 mm) W 0.32 in (8 mm) D Mass: List. 4th generation antibody/antigen (Ab/Ag) tests: 45 days. 3rd generation antibody only tests: 60 days. Point of care tests (self-sampling, self-testing and rapid tests: 90 days. During the window period a person can have HIV and be very infectious but still test HIV negative. Fourth-generation HIV tests are different from third-generation tests, which can only detect HIV antibodies. In contrast, fourth-generation tests detect both HIV antibodies and p24 antigens. This allows them to identify the virus sooner than the earlier tests. A potential exposure to human immunodeficiency virus (HIV) might make someone wonder how soon they can get results from a test.
